In a bid to bolster its urban infrastructure and mitigate the impacts of extreme weather events, the city has embarked on an ambitious project to install flood control gates throughout its key waterways and drainage systems. This strategic initiative aims to enhance water management capabilities, ensuring that both residents and businesses remain protected against potential flooding hazards.
The flood control gates, designed with cutting-edge technology, are engineered to withstand the rigorous demands of heavy rainfall and rapid water flow. They operate via an automated system that monitors water levels in real-time, adjusting their positions accordingly to regulate the flow of water efficiently. This smart integration not only aids in preventing overflow but also assists in maintaining optimal water levels within the city's drainage networks.
